MAC Eyeshadow Palettes: My Oranges, Yellows, Golds -- Limited Edition

It’s Sunday, so why not have some fun and play guess-the-MAC-eyeshadows?  But in a way more epic way, since MAC has put out a bajillion limited edition shades.  Hey, I can’t even name all of these without cheating, and I’ve owned them for years…

Some clues…

  • All shades are limited edition (I have all permanent shades in separate palettes)
  • 95% of my limited edition eyeshadows are from 2004-2010, with an emphasis on 2009-2010
  • There may be duplicates of some limited edition shades
  • Square-shaped shades are from holiday palettes

What’s inside the palette…

Top Row: Fab & Flashy, Off the Page, Pollinator, Evening Aura, Straw Harvest
Middle Row: Flip, Jasmine, Bright Future, Going Bananas, Crest the Wave
Bottom Row: Dreammaker, Creme de Miel, Creme de Miel, Dreammaker, Rose Blanc
